
Akash Goswami contributed to the snyk/broker repository by focusing on backend reliability, security, and maintainability over a three-month period. He stabilized dependency management using Node.js and TypeScript, implementing targeted sub-dependency overrides to prevent build-time conflicts and ensure consistent deployments. Akash also optimized the Docker-based deployment pipeline by removing unnecessary packages from the UBI image, reducing both image size and vulnerability surface. In addition, he enhanced observability by introducing request ID logging for improved error tracking and upgraded core dependencies such as dotenv. His work demonstrated depth in Docker, Linux, and backend development, resulting in a more robust and maintainable codebase.
